About Toole Design
Toole Design is the leading engineering, planning, and landscape architecture firm specializing in multimodal transportation in North America. Since our start in 2003 as a single office in Maryland, we have expanded to 17 offices throughout the United States. We are proud of our award-winning work that has transformed communities large and small. As an Engineering News-Record top 500 design firm, we have also been named a "best firm to work for" and have one of the lowest staff turnover rates in the industry.
A Day in the Life of a CFO
As the CFO of the company, you will work directly with our President, our COO, and our senior-most leadership to help chart the course of the company's future. You will oversee all our financial activities, maintaining the integrity of accounting procedures, records and internal controls. You will help make decisions that support our bottom line and strengthen our mission.
You will lead a 20-person financial team that is currently in place, and will be actively engaged in the hiring of staff to grow your team. Your leadership will create a productive and supportive environment, fostering a culture of mentorship and collaboration to bring out the best in each team member.

Responsibilities of a Chief Financial Officer:
- Effectively manage and mentor the accounting team, ensuring the entire team is working together effectively and efficiently, and fulfilling the accounting needs of the company.
- Oversee financial/accounting operations of the organization, including financial planning, budgeting, audits, forecasting, reporting, payroll, and key performance matrices per best practice.
- Oversee and manage all treasury functions, including cash management, financial investments, banking relationships, and tax strategy among others.
- Coordinate with all department leads to ensure resources are strategically allocated and effectively utilized and that Toole Design meets its annual financial goals and targets.
- Serve as a strategic partner to the Executive Team and other senior managers, counseling them on financial matters and the development of policy relating to improving the financial management
